Understanding Your Market


Before implementing any sales strategies, it's crucial to understand your target market. Who are your customers? What are their needs and preferences? Conducting market research can provide valuable insights.


Identify Your Ideal Customer


  • Demographics: Consider age, income level, and location. Are your customers primarily families, retirees, or young professionals?

  • Pain Points: What challenges do they face regarding pool maintenance? Understanding their problems can help you tailor your services to meet their needs.


Analyze Competitors


Take a close look at your competitors. What services do they offer? What are their pricing strategies? Identifying gaps in the market can help you position your services more effectively.


Building a Strong Online Presence


In today's digital age, having a robust online presence is essential for attracting new customers. Here are some strategies to enhance your visibility:


Create a User-Friendly Website


Your website is often the first impression potential customers will have of your business. Ensure it is:


  • Easy to Navigate: Visitors should find information quickly.

  • Mobile-Friendly: Many users will access your site from mobile devices.

  • Informative: Include details about your services, pricing, and contact information.


Utilize Search Engine Optimization (SEO)


Optimizing your website for search engines can help you rank higher in search results. Focus on:


  • Keywords: Use relevant keywords related to pool services throughout your site.

  • Local SEO: Optimize for local searches by including your location in keywords and creating a Google My Business profile.


Leveraging Social Proof


Social proof can significantly influence potential customers' decisions. Here’s how to use it effectively:


Collect Customer Reviews


Encourage satisfied customers to leave reviews on platforms like Google and Yelp. Positive testimonials can build trust and credibility.


Showcase Case Studies


Highlight successful projects on your website. Include before-and-after photos and detailed descriptions of the work done. This not only demonstrates your expertise but also helps potential customers visualize the results.


Offering Value-Added Services


To stand out from the competition, consider offering value-added services that enhance your core offerings:


Maintenance Packages


Create maintenance packages that provide regular service at a discounted rate. This encourages customers to commit to long-term service.


Seasonal Promotions


Offer seasonal promotions, such as discounts on pool opening or closing services. This can attract customers during peak times.


Networking and Partnerships


Building relationships within your community can lead to new business opportunities. Consider the following:


Collaborate with Local Businesses


Partner with local businesses that complement your services, such as landscaping companies or home improvement stores. Cross-promotions can expand your reach.


Attend Community Events


Participate in local events, such as fairs or home shows. This provides an opportunity to showcase your services and connect with potential customers face-to-face.


Effective Sales Techniques


Once you have attracted potential customers, it’s essential to convert them into paying clients. Here are some effective sales techniques:


Personalize Your Approach


Tailor your sales pitch to meet the specific needs of each customer. Listen actively to their concerns and provide solutions that address their unique situations.


Follow Up


After an initial consultation or quote, follow up with potential customers. A simple phone call or email can show that you care and keep your business top of mind.


Utilizing Technology


Incorporating technology into your business operations can streamline processes and improve customer experience:


Use Scheduling Software


Implement scheduling software to manage appointments efficiently. This can reduce missed appointments and improve customer satisfaction.


Offer Online Booking


Allow customers to book services online. This convenience can attract more clients and make the process easier for both parties.


Training and Development


Investing in your team is crucial for providing excellent service. Consider the following:


Ongoing Training


Provide regular training for your staff on the latest pool maintenance techniques and customer service skills. A knowledgeable team can enhance customer satisfaction and retention.


Encourage Feedback


Create a culture of feedback where employees can share their ideas for improving services. This can lead to innovative solutions and a more engaged workforce.


Measuring Success


To ensure your strategies are effective, it’s essential to measure your success. Here are some key performance indicators (KPIs) to track:


Customer Acquisition Cost


Calculate how much it costs to acquire a new customer. This can help you determine the effectiveness of your marketing strategies.


Customer Retention Rate


Monitor how many customers continue to use your services over time. A high retention rate indicates satisfied customers and effective service.


Revenue Growth


Track your revenue growth over time to assess the overall success of your sales strategies.
